What is the first stage of destination development?

The first stage is the exploration stage [8]. It is present when individual tourists start to appear in small numbers in a given area, attracted by natural or cultural aspects.

According to Butler (1980), under destination life cycle, an area undergo an evolutionary cycle of six stages. These stages are exploration, involvement, development, consolidation, stagnation and decline. Mostly all tourists' destinations passes through all these mentioned stages.
